    Update:

    Last Saturday morning, I went to meet the seller to return the fake AirPods, but he ignored my calls and texts. After sending him a polite message about going to the police, I continued trying to contact him. Eventually, I asked around and found his home. A woman there, possibly his sister, told me he wasn’t home and to try calling after 12. I left without sharing any details of the issue with her.

    Later, at around 10 AM, he texted me, sarcastically saying to go ahead and complain to the police, adding that he’d accuse me of swapping out the AirPods’ parts. This crossed the line for me, so I responded that we should meet at the police station, and I headed straight to the local police station in his neighborhood.

    At the police station, I explained the situation, and they called him in. After about 30 minutes, he arrived and, despite his boasting about owning boats and being able to buy 100 AirPods, he eventually agreed to write a letter promising to refund my money by October 10th.

    The next day, he texted me, asking how I found his house, claiming he had filed complaints with the police and the bank, alleging that someone inside the bank gave me his address. I clarified that I simply asked around for him by name, but he insisted that he would recomplain and address his privacy concerns, while still promising to refund the money.

    I wanted to buy Apple AirPods Pro 2nd Gen because of the new upcoming hearing aid feature. My father has hearing issues and we can’t afford new hearing aids.

    I saw a used pair of AirPods Pro 2nd Gen on ikman lk and after contacting the seller I visited him and bought the AirPods for 30K on 18th September.

    I checked the AirPods on the spot but I couldn’t say it was a fake one because I haven’t used one before. It felt all is fine but when I got home and dig deeper I realized I got scammed.

    I told this to the seller on the same day and he agreed to accept the return. He told me to wait till Saturday (21) but today it’s 25th of September and he keeps giving me excuses.

    What can I do in this situation. I really need that money because I worked so hard to save the money and I wanted to give my father something nice after a long time.

    I have the online money transfer receipt and whatsapp conversations and his ikman ad screenshots.
